  • Abstract
    In this work, we combine the field of cloud computing with assisted living to utilize an improved activity classification. The proposed system addresses the challenge of enabling heterogeneous, cloud-based sensors in small home environments. With a semantic and model-based approach, we seamlessly integrate Web services as virtual sensors and, therefore, increasing the accuracy of human activity classifiers. We solve the most important compelling issue of interoperability, by using generated wrapper classes and semantically unify all heterogeneous sensor events within the system. Our approach is evaluated with a test installation by means of the requirements for Sensor Web Infrastructures combined with the one for assisted living environments.
